Apiston–cylinder device with a set of stops initially contains 0.6 kg of steam at 1.0 mpa and 400°c. the location of the stops corresponds to 40 percent of the initial volume. now the steam is cooled. determine the compression work if the final state is (a) 1.0 mpa and 250°c and (b) 500 kpa. (c) also determine the temperature at the final state in part (b).

Ahair dryer is basically a duct in which a few layers of electric resistors are placed. a small fan pulls the air in and forces it through the resistors where it is heated. air enters a 1200 w hair dryer at 100 kpa and 22°c and leaves at 47°c. the cross-sectional area of the hair dryer at the exit is 60 cm2. neglecting the power consumed by the fan and the heat losses through the walls of the hair dryer, determine (a) the volume flow rate of air at the inlet and (b) the velocity of the air at the exit.
